How to read greens using aimpoint express

What is Aim Point Putting? And how does it work? AimPoint is an express method of reading the break on a putt as you play, using a three-step system designed to help you read every putt accurately and consistently. Adding distance to your drives

When you talk about the concept of speed in the golf swing, it’s easy to get confused and frustrated. Many players’ first instinct–to make their hands and arms go as fast as possible right at the ball–leads to things that actually make the swing slower.
